Isi questions harsh penalty after Rayo Vallecano’s narrow loss to Espanyol
Rayo Vallecano started poorly, struggling to build attacks in the first half. Their task grew harder when they were reduced to ten players early in the second period. Despite the setback, they fought hard but could not find an equaliser.
The defeat keeps Rayo Vallecano under pressure in the league table. With a full squad available next time, they will look to bounce back. Meanwhile, Espanyol take three points but will reflect on missed opportunities to extend their lead.
